1. Understand Your Energy Usage Habits 

Before comparing rates, take a look at your own consumption. Are you running large appliances during peak hours? Do you leave lights on unnecessarily or use older appliances? Your behavior can impact your bill as much as your rate. 
 
Tip: Use a smart thermostat, switch to LED lighting, and schedule high-energy tasks like laundry or dishwashing for off-peak hours. 

2. Know When Energy Prices Fluctuate 

Electricity pricing often follows seasonal and market trends. Rates can rise during high-demand periods like summer or winter. Choosing a fixed-rate plan during lower-cost months can help you lock in a better deal before prices rise. 

3. Choose the Right Plan Type for You 

There’s no one-size-fits-all energy plan. Here are your main options:

  • Fixed-rate plans: Lock in a single rate for the length of your contract. Best for budget predictability.
  • Variable-rate plans: Rates change based on market conditions. You might save in low-demand months, but risk higher prices later.
  • Time-of-use plans: Rates vary based on time of day. Run appliances at night or early morning to save.
Tip: If you prefer stable, predictable bills, fixed-rate plans are usually the safest option. 

4. Think Long-Term vs. Short-Term Contracts 

Short-term energy plans offer flexibility, but they rarely offer the lowest rate. Longer contracts often provide more cost protection over time, shielding you from inflation or seasonal price hikes.

5. Consider Sustainability and Source 

Not all energy is created equal. Choosing a renewable or low-carbon energy plan can help reduce your environmental impact. Clean energy options, such as solar, wind, and nuclear, now rival or beat fossil fuel pricing in many regions. 
 
Tip: If sustainability is a priority, ask if your plan includes 100% renewable or carbon-free energy sources. 

The Smarter Way to Shop Energy Rates 

When you shop for electricity, focus on more than just price. Ask questions like: Is this a fixed or variable plan?  How long is the contract term? Is this rate sustainable and reliable over time?
